Cheapest Available Sun City 1 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Sun City of Las Vegas, NV is the 1 BEDROOM Model starting from $1,239 at Shadow Hills at Lone Mountain.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Sun City is currently $1,611.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
Shadow Hills at Lone Mountain1 BEDROOM$1,239
The Boulders at Lone MountainDeer Valley$1,278
Parc West ApartmentsThe Grayson$1,323
Tierra VillasSavannah$1,364
EstanciaOne Bedroom$1,529
